Incident & Issue Management Coordinator

Own the full lifecycle of high-severity incidents and control issues for a regulated fintech, including triage, remediation tracking, root cause analysis, regulatory reporting, and driving items into engineering backlogs. Requires 1-3 years in incident/issue management or operational risk in financial services, plus strong coordination and communication skills.

About the role

What You'll Do

  • Own the full P0 and P1 incident lifecycle — declaration, triage, cross-functional response, root cause analysis, remediation, and formal closure — documented to regulatory standards.
  • Take ownership of any incident with customer impact requiring remediation, regardless of severity, working alongside Engineering managers who lead technical recovery for P2, P3, and P4 incidents.
  • Run incident response coordination, keeping clear ownership, action items, and decision logs, and escalating to second-line Compliance, Risk, and bank partners when thresholds are met.
  • Own the first-line issue management lifecycle: identify, document, and classify issues arising from incidents, audits, exams, monitoring, or day-to-day observations, each with a defined owner, remediation plan, and target closure date.
  • Maintain the issue log with the same discipline as the incident log, driving issues through to closure and confirming control gaps are genuinely addressed, not just marked closed.
  • Own the remediation tracking process for both incidents and issues, maintaining a consolidated tracker formatted for sharing with auditors, examiners, and bank partners.
  • Ensure all technology remediation items get into Engineering backlogs or sprint planning commitments, partnering with Engineering managers and the Director of Business Technology.
  • Run a structured program cadence, including recurring incident and issue review meetings across Engineering, Compliance, and Operations, and ad hoc working sessions as needed.
  • Own and evolve Credit Genie's incident and issue management framework — policies, playbooks, escalation protocols, severity classifications, and SLA standards.
  • Drive continuous improvement through structured post-incident reviews, root cause analysis, and lessons-learned processes that translate into real control improvements.
  • Serve as the primary first-line contact for regulatory examiner and bank partner inquiries, preparing accurate, complete responses and evidence packages.
  • Own preparation of incident and issue management reporting for the board and compliance committee, including trend analysis, remediation phase tracking, and program health metrics.
  • Identify and implement AI and automation tools to cut administrative burden, accelerate reporting, and improve tracking accuracy across the program.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ree or MBA from an accredited institution.
  • 1-3 years of relevant pre-MBA experience in incident management, issue management, operational risk, or a related control function within fintech, financial services, or a regulated environment.
  • Some experience managing high-severity incidents or control issues through part of the full lifecycle: triage, remediation tracking, root cause analysis, or closure.
  • Clear understanding of the distinction between incidents and issues in a regulated context.
  • Some experience coordinating with Engineering or technical teams, with a working understanding of backlog management and sprint planning.
  • Familiarity with regulatory expectations for incident and issue management programs in a bank-partnered or licensed fintech environment.
  • Comfortable working with AI tools to automate administrative workflows, generate summaries, and streamline program operations.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to translate technical and operational findings into clear reporting for compliance teams, senior leadership, and regulators.

Nice to Have

  • Experience preparing materials for bank partner requests, regulatory exams, or board-level reporting.
  • Relevant certifications (e.g., ITIL, PMP, CRISC).
